SEACORP is seeking a well-qualified DevOps Engineer.

Primary Duties and Responsibilities:

Job Summary: SEACORP'sPlatforms Business Area has an immediate need for a full-time DevOps Engineer professional with a Secret clearance based at our Middletown,Rhode Island site. The selected applicant will perform work to assist with themanagement of DoD systems. While these positions will mostly have regularbusiness hours, some travel will be required.

Job Responsibilities Include:

  • Installation, configuration, troubleshooting, and maintenance of server and systems configurations (hardware and software) to ensure their confidentiality, integrity, and availability.
  • Candidate would administer server-based systems, security devices, distributed applications, network storage, messaging, and performs systems monitoring.
  • Potential to consult on network, and application issues to support computer systems’ security and sustainability.

Qualifications:

Education: Bachelor's degree in atechnical field including but not limited to Engineering, Computer Science, orComputer Engineering, is preferred. Advanced military technical training(e.g. Navy "C" School) and 6 years’ experience in military systems(e.g., service abroad a naval ship) with an additional 3 years of professionalexperience in systems engineering can be substituted for a Bachelor's degree.

Experience: Minimum of 3 years ofrelated work experience, preferably in IT.

Ideal Skills and Experience:

  • A current Windows Administration certification is preferred. Successful completion of training in Windows Administration will be required within the first 6 months of hire.
  • Candidates must meet baseline eligibility for Cyber Security Workforce (CSWF) at the DoD 8570-M Information Assurance Manager, Level I (IAT-I) and/or DoD 8140 Intermediate/Journeyman in Specialty Area 451. Examples of industry certification meeting this requirement is CompTIA’s A+(ce), or Network+(ce) credential. CompTIA’s Security+(ce) credential a plus.
  • Experience with DoD Cybersecurity, System Engineering, and/or Test & Evaluation processes is desired.
  • Understanding of the application of policy, process, and technical controls.
  • Position requires familiarity with System Development Life Cycle (SDLC), System Engineering process, Risk Management Framework (RMF) Authorization and Accreditation (A&A) processes and the National Institute of Standards and Technology (NIST) 800 series of special publications and other applicable DoD requirements.
  • Experience with the implementation of security controls, STIG application, and scanning on current Linux and/or Windows versions is necessary.
